Non-Communicable Disease Specialist Deadline: 17-Oct-2022 23:59 (Gmt 8.00) Beijing, Perth, Singapore, Hong Kong Background In The Context Of Ncds, The Who Country Office In Solomon Islands Supports The Implementation Of Strategies That Address Access To Services, Determinants Of Health, And Availability Of Essential Medicines And Devices For Primary Health Care. The Who Co Ncd Team Provides Support To The Mhms And In The Context Of Technical And Administrative Support To The Noncommunicable Diseases (Ncd) Programme And Related Assignments. Additionally, The Who Co Ncd Team Coordinates Activities To Strengthen Ncd Prevention And Monitoring Of Key Ncd Risk Factors. The Team Collaborate Closely With Key Partners Across And Outside The Mhms. Who Country Office In The Solomon Islands Is Part Of Who Western Pacific Region. Under The Overall Leadership Of Who Representative, And Reporting To Technical Officer/Ncd, The Consultant Will Perform And Deliver The Outputs As Indicated In The Terms Of Reference In A Timely Manner. Purpose/Specific Objective Of The Activity To Develop The Ncd Coaching Guidelines And Monitoring And Evaluation Framework To Support The Implementation Of Noncommunicable Programmes In The Solomon Islands In Collaboration With The Ministry Of Health And Medical Services And Who Representative Office. Description Of Activities To Be Carried Out Output 1:Identify And Prioritize Three Interventions For Ncd Programmes Output 2: Develop A Draft M&E Framework Around The Selected Interventions Output 3: Develop And Test Coaching On The Selected Interventions Output 4: Develop And Test Qi Tool On The Selected Interventions Output 5: Revision Of The M&E Framework Output 6: Select The Next Interventions And Repeat The Above Process Methods To Carry Out The Activity The Consultant Will Work Collaboratively With The Who Ncd Team And The Mhms Partners To Develop The Coaching Guidelines, Qi Tools And Draft The M&E Framework, And Conduct Field Tests To Ensure Applicability In The Country. Qualifications & Experience Education Essential: University Degree In Medicine, Public Health Or Related Health Studies. Desirable: MasterS Degree In Public Health From A Recognized University And/Or Training/S In Public Health At Postgraduate Degree Level Or Its Equivalent. Experience Essential: At Least Five 5 Years Of Relevant Experience In Developing M&E Frameworks, And Coaching And Quality Improvement Approaches (E.G., Early Essential Newborn Care, Primary Health Care Quality Improvement Guides). Desirable: Relevant Experience In Implementation Of Noncommunicable Diseases Programmes Or Other Areas Giving Experience For Implementing The Tors. Previous Experience At The Field Level In Who, Un Organizations/Agencies, Particularly In Developing Countries. Experience Working In Pics Is An Asset. Technical Skills & Knowledge Knowledge Of The Specific Or Technical Area Of Public Health. Health Planning At Operational, Subnational, And National Levels, With Political And Technical Elements. Capacity-Building Through Multiple Methods, Including Training, Mentoring And Example Setting. Ability To Establish Harmonious Working Relationships As Part Of A Team, Adapt To Diverse Educational And Cultural Backgrounds, And Maintain A High Standard Of Personal Conduct. Ability To Demonstrate Gender Equity And Cultural Appropriateness In The Delivery Of Services To Member State.
